Understanding Life Coaching and Its Scope

Life coaching has emerged as a popular field, promising to help individuals unlock their potential, achieve goals, and overcome obstacles. However, it’s crucial to understand what life coaching entails and, equally important, what it does not. The role of a life coach is distinct from that of a therapist, counsellor, or mentor, and discerning these differences is essential for anyone seeking personal development support.

What is Life Coaching?

Life coaching is a forward-looking process focused on helping individuals identify and achieve personal and professional goals. A life coach typically works with clients to:

  • Clarify Vision: Help clients articulate their aspirations, values, and what truly matters to them.
  • Identify Obstacles: Pinpoint internal and external barriers preventing progress, such as limiting beliefs, procrastination, or lack of clarity.
  • Develop Strategies: Collaborate with clients to create actionable plans and step-by-step strategies to move towards their objectives.
  • Provide Accountability: Offer support and accountability to ensure clients follow through on their commitments and maintain momentum.
  • Facilitate Self-Discovery: Through powerful questioning and reflective exercises, coaches guide clients to find their own answers and insights.

Life coaching is fundamentally about empowerment and future orientation. It assumes the client is resourceful and capable, and the coach’s role is to facilitate the client’s own journey of discovery and action. According to the International Coaching Federation (ICF), coaching is defined as “partnering with clients in a thought-provoking and creative process that inspires them to maximize their personal and professional potential.” The global coaching industry was valued at approximately $15 billion in 2019, reflecting its widespread adoption.

The Distinction Between Coaching, Therapy, and Mentoring

One of the most critical aspects to understand about life coaching is its boundaries, particularly when compared to therapy and mentoring.

  • Coaching vs. Therapy: Therapy (or counselling) typically focuses on mental health issues, healing past traumas, addressing emotional disorders, and deep-seated psychological patterns. Therapists are licensed mental health professionals with extensive clinical training. A life coach is not qualified to diagnose or treat mental health conditions. While a coach might touch upon mental well-being, if deeper psychological issues arise, a responsible coach will refer the client to a licensed therapist. The Mental Health Foundation in the UK consistently highlights the importance of seeking qualified help for clinical mental health needs, distinguishing it from general well-being support.
  • Coaching vs. Mentoring: Mentoring involves an experienced individual guiding a less experienced one, usually within a specific field or industry. A mentor shares their knowledge, wisdom, and network based on their own journey. Coaching, on the other hand, is less about telling or advising and more about facilitating the client’s own thinking and solutions. A coach may not have direct experience in the client’s specific field but possesses expertise in the coaching process itself.
  • Coaching vs. Consulting: Consultants provide expert advice and solutions to specific problems within a business or industry. They are hired for their specialised knowledge to solve a particular issue, whereas a coach facilitates the client’s own problem-solving capabilities.

Ethical Considerations in Life Coaching

The life coaching industry is largely unregulated in many parts of the world, including the UK, which means virtually anyone can call themselves a life coach.   • Transparency of Qualifications: Reputable coaches will openly share their certifications (e.g., from ICF, EMCC, or Association for Coaching), training, and professional experience.
  • Clear Boundaries: Coaches should clearly communicate the scope of their services and when it might be appropriate to refer a client to another professional (e.g., a therapist or financial advisor).
  • Confidentiality: Maintaining client confidentiality is paramount.
  • No Guarantees of Outcomes: While coaches aim to help clients achieve goals, they cannot guarantee specific outcomes, as success largely depends on the client’s effort and external factors.
  • Ethical Pricing: Pricing should be transparent and communicated clearly upfront, avoiding hidden fees or ambiguous structures.

For individuals exploring life coaching, it is advisable to seek coaches who are affiliated with recognised professional bodies, have clear and verifiable credentials, and are transparent about their fees and the boundaries of their services. This due diligence ensures a safer and potentially more effective coaching experience.

Key Factors to Consider When Choosing an Online Coach

Given the unregulated nature of much of the coaching industry, due diligence is paramount when selecting an online service.

  • Coach Credentials and Experience: Look for coaches with verifiable certifications from reputable coaching organisations (e.g., ICF, EMCC, Association for Coaching). These organisations often have ethical guidelines and standards of practice that their certified members must adhere to. A coach’s specific experience relevant to your goals (e.g., business coaching, relationship coaching) is also crucial. A recent report by the ICF indicated that 89% of coaching clients found their coach to be highly effective when the coach held a certification from a recognised body.
  • Transparency in Pricing: A reputable service will clearly state its fees upfront. This might be per session, a package deal, or a subscription model. Be wary of services that require extensive engagement before revealing costs or that have hidden fees. Transparent pricing builds trust and allows for proper financial planning.
  • Client Testimonials and Reviews: While website testimonials can be curated, look for third-party review platforms (like Trustpilot, Google Reviews) to get a more balanced perspective. Pay attention to the number of reviews and the consistency of feedback. However, remember that reviews alone don’t tell the whole story.
  • Communication Channels and Technology: Ensure the platform uses secure and reliable communication methods (e.g., encrypted video conferencing). Understand how sessions will be conducted, how you can communicate between sessions, and what technical support is available.
  • Initial Consultation or Discovery Call: A free introductory session is standard practice. Use this opportunity to assess the coach’s style, ask direct questions about their methodology, qualifications, and fees, and determine if there’s a good rapport. This is your chance to interview them.
  • Privacy and Data Security: Understand how your personal information and session content will be handled. The platform should have a clear privacy policy that outlines data protection measures, especially given the sensitive nature of personal coaching discussions. In the UK, compliance with GDPR (General Data Protection Regulation) is a legal requirement.

How can I verify the credentials of a life coach?

To verify a life coach’s credentials, you should ask for their specific certifications, the name of the certifying body (e.g., International Coaching Federation), and their unique credential number, which can then often be verified on the certifying body’s website.
